Variables ¶
var ( ErrErrantTransactions = errors.New("detected errant transactions") ErrNoTopRunner = errors.New("unable to determine the top runner") ErrTimeout = errors.New("timeout") )
Sentinel errors. To test these errors, use `errors.Is`.
var ErrNop = errors.New("nop")
ErrNop is a sentinel error for NopOperator

func FindTopRunner ¶ added in v0.18.0
FindTopRunner returns the index of the slice whose `GlobalVariables.ExecutedGtidSet` is most advanced. This may return ErrErrantTransactions for errant transactions or ErrNoTopRunner if there is no such instance.

type Operator ¶
type Operator interface {
// Name is the name of the MySQL instance for which this operator works.
Name() string
// Close closes the underlying connections.
Close() error
// GetStatus reports the instance status.
GetStatus(context.Context) (*MySQLInstanceStatus, error)
// SubtractGTID returns GTID subset of set1 that are not in set2.
SubtractGTID(ctx context.Context, set1, set2 string) (string, error)
// IsSubsetGTID returns true if set1 is a subset of set2.
IsSubsetGTID(ctx context.Context, set1, set2 string) (bool, error)
// ConfigureReplica configures client-side replication.
// If `symisync` is true, it enables client-side semi-synchronous replication.
// In either case, it disables server-side semi-synchronous replication.
ConfigureReplica(ctx context.Context, source AccessInfo, semisync bool) error
// ConfigurePrimary configures server-side semi-synchronous replication.
// For asynchronous replication, this method should not be called.
ConfigurePrimary(ctx context.Context, waitForCount int) error
// StopReplicaIOThread executes `STOP REPLICA IO_THREAD`.
StopReplicaIOThread(context.Context) error
// WaitForGTID waits for `mysqld` to execute all GTIDs in `gtidSet`.
// If timeout happens, this return ErrTimeout.
// If `timeoutSeconds` is zero, this will not timeout.
WaitForGTID(ctx context.Context, gtidSet string, timeoutSeconds int) error
// SetReadOnly makes the instance super_read_only if `true` is passed.
// Otherwise, this stops the replication and makes the instance writable.
SetReadOnly(context.Context, bool) error
// KillConnections kills all connections except for ones from `localhost`
// and ones for MOCO.
KillConnections(context.Context) error
}
Operator represents a set of operations for a MySQL instance.

func NewFactory ¶
func NewFactory(r Resolver) OperatorFactory
NewFactory returns a new OperatorFactory that resolves instance IP address using `r`. If `r.Resolve` returns an error, the `New` method will return a NopOperator.
